When the secondary speaker’s mini cable is connected to the main unit, the main unit automatically acts as the left channel while the secondary speaker becomes the right channel. To detach the secondary speaker, get a fi rm grasp and pull until all 4 pins are released from the grommets. When the secondary speaker’s mini cable is disconnected from the main unit, the main unit automatically becomes mono. The remote will only operate an iPod when it is docked in the iSongBook. When it comes time to replace the remote’s battery, use only a major brand name 3V Lithium battery with model number compatible with CR2025. Slide the battery cover off and install the new battery with the positive “+” side facing up. Note: The remote control functions are not affected by the “hold” switch on an iPod. Specifi cations ™ Model: Tivoli Audio iSongBook Type: FM/AM Digital Portable Stereo Radio with iPod Dock Drivers: 2 x 2.5" (2 x 6.35 cm) full-range Receiving Bands: FM: 87.5–108 MHz AM: 520–1710kHz (522–1629kHz using 9k Step) De–Emphasis: 75uSec UL/50uSec CE Dimensions: 11" W x 6.19" H x 2.19" D 27.94 cm W x 15.72 cm H x 5.56 cm D Weight: 2.81 lbs.
